Requirements for maritime positioning are changing
GNSS interference is no longer rare: jamming and spoofing are increasingly part of the operational reality.
At the same time, bridge systems are more connected than ever, raising cyber expectations and integration complexity.
Yet many shipboard solutions remain expensive, slow to evolve, and hard to integrate.
New capabilities exist, but they rarely reach the bridge as simple, certifiable solutions.
What’s needed is practical resilience: measurable performance, simple integration, and scalable robustness when conditions get tough.

Multiple GNSS receiver products
Our receiver portfolio combines multi‑constellation, multi‑frequency GNSS with advanced integrity monitoring to deliver resilient positioning and heading. Designed to serve every GNSS‑driven bridge function, our modular sensors support everything from basic position outputs to heading, rate-of-turn, speed, roll/pitch and high‑precision services, all on a common platform.
Norse user interface
Lightweight monitoring and configuration software that is both embeddable in existing bridge systems and standalone displays, providing clear status, diagnostics, and compliant UI. Design inspired by OpenBridge and user-centric functionality for easy commisioning, service and daily use by operators.
